Locations: Croydon

Job Type: Full-time, Office-Based

Hours: Monday - Friday, 08:00-17:00

Salary: £40,000 - £45,000 (DOE)

About the Role

We are looking for an experienced Bodyshop Estimator / VDA Estimator to join our accident repair centres in Croydon or Whitstable. This is a full-time, office-based position where you will complete accurate vehicle damage assessments.

How to prepare for a job interview at United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ia

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of vehicle damage assessment. Familiarise yourself with common types of damage and the estimating process. Being able to discuss specific examples from your past experience will show that you know what you're talking about.

Showcase Your Attention to Detail

As a Vehicle Damage Assessor, attention to detail is crucial. During the interview, highlight instances where your keen eye for detail made a difference in your work. This could be anything from spotting hidden damage to ensuring accurate estimates.

Prepare Questions

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are thoughtful questions about the company’s processes, team dynamics, or future projects. This not only shows your interest but also helps you determine if the company is the right fit for you.

Dress the Part

Even though it’s an office-based role, first impressions matter. Dress smartly to convey professionalism. It shows that you take the opportunity seriously and respect the interviewers’ time.
